Ariete

IOC: 1995
Total Production: 200



Origin:Italy

Contractor/s: IVECO, Oto Melara

Description: The Ariete is a main battle tank (MBT) with greater firepower, improved armor protection and mobility than current Leopard 1 in service in the Italian Army. It can engage stationary or moving targets during day and night even on the move employing its L44 120mm (44 calibers) smoothbore stabilized gun.

It is powered by a 1,300-hp diesel engine with fully automatic transmission. The Ariete features a gunner's thermal sight and a commander's stabilized panoramic day/night sight which provides hunter-killer capability to the Ariete main battle tank.
